Nowadays, in the knowledge economy and information economy age, information and technology have been core factors in the development of economy taking the place of traditional economic factors such as resources, common labor and capital. Creation becomes the most flourishing economic activities. The advanced cities in the world have stepping into the "creative city" or "knowledge city" stage successively. As a result, in the new round of international urban competition, the cities which possessing of sufficient talents and better research platform will become the leaders of world cities. College city—the complex of dense talents and perfect research conditions become more and more important in the socio-economic development. What's more, most of the world-famous Science Parks have grown up in the basis of college city, such as Silicon Valley, Research Triangle Park of North Carolina and 128 highway region in the U.S.A., Tsukuba town of the Japan, Cambridge town in the U.K., Hsinchu town in Taiwan province of China.In these backgrounds, an upsurge of college city has sprung up in our country since 2000. There are more than 50 college cities in the whole country now, their developing step and area scale are astonishing. However, the college cities in our country are rather spotty and have many problems for misunderstanding and lack of research. Therefore, it is greatly necessary to figure out the meaning of college city, to benefit from experiences of international college cities, to sum up models and characteristics and to analyze specific problems in the practical construction of our country's college cities. Valuable ideas have been put forward to assist the development of college cities in our country.The full paper is totally divided into seven chapters. The introduction part introduces the backgrounds, significance, relevant research, research methods and frame of the thesis. Chapter one analyzes and defines the intension of college city. Chapter two presents the international experiences of college cities, in the case of Cambridge college city and Oxford college city of the U.K., Tsukuba University city of Japan, Cambridge college city of Boston in the U.S.A. Then analyze the revelation for our country's college cities. Chapter three discusses the backgrounds of college city's rise in our country in great detail. Chapter four introduces the types and characteristics of our country's college cities briefly. Chapter five analyzes and summarizes spatial models of our country's college cities , and puts forward five types of spatial models of college city, in the basis of importing the concepts of college city. Then it analyzes every kind of spatial model of college city in brief. Chapter six, introducing New economic growth theory, analyzes it's regional interactive effect from five aspects: high and new technology industry, tourist industry, service industry, labor quality and realty business. Chapter seven brings forward exploratory thinking toward the change of college city's spatial model through theoretical analysis and field research in the case of Songjiang college city.
